Trader consensus currently centers on a 17°C high for Wellington on August 30, carrying 52% implied probability, as short-range ensemble forecasts from global models indicate a moderating high-pressure ridge bringing lighter northerly flows and daytime maxima near seasonal norms for late winter. Recent runs show tight clustering around 16–18°C, with 18°C at 32.5% reflecting minor warm-air advection potential if the ridge strengthens slightly. Key variables include cloud cover and wind shifts that could suppress or elevate readings by 1–2°C, consistent with historical variability in the region where August maxima average near 13–15°C but have reached 17°C in analogous setups. Updated MetService guidance and next model cycles over the next 24 hours will likely refine these probabilities ahead of resolution.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the highest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=nzwn
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market can not resolve until the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
